Home-base (docking) locations must be identified. After placing the initial STC robots in a secluded
hallway, we later created alcoves for the robots, such that the stationary robots are not in the hallway but are
slightly recessed. Another practical consideration is the presence or anticipation of other pharmacy-based
or non-pharmacy-based robots.
Robots may be decentralized or centralized (i.e., designated only for
a specific home base, shared among pharmacy-based satellites, or shared among pharmacy and nonpharmacy
departments). The concept of a pharmacy-based pool of robots to
be summoned by any pharmacy, or
of a hospital-based pool of robots to
be summoned by any department, is
intriguing.
